[0057] An energy-efficiency optimization control method for a dual-electrically coupled fuel cell vehicle based on an adaptive genetic algorithm is realized based on a dual-electrically coupled fuel cell power system, which includes a power battery pack, a fuel cell engine, a bidirectional DCDC converter, hydrogen supply system, vehicle control system, lithium-ion battery system, super capacitor pack, drive motor, drive motor control system and transmission;
